Abstract

Sophistication in the aviation and warfare technologies has significantly increased the use of metals such as aluminium, magnesium and their alloys for numerous applications. The resulting fires of such metals are probably one of the most dominating and devastating risks if the metals are in the form of fine particles. The work consists of determination of the constituents of the various combustion products after the burning of the magnesium, aluminium and aluminium-magnesium alloy powder heaps on the sand bed. The analysis of the ground products of burnt metal powders on the sand bed has been carried out by using X-ray diffractometer. It is found that oxides and nitrides were the predominant fractions of the combustion products of the metal powders. Interestingly, it is also found that the combustion products of the aluminium, and the aluminium-magnesium alloy powder heap on the sand bed contain free aluminium also.
